Job description

Are you a service-minded engineer who wants to get the chance to travel across the globe to support the green Energy transition? Welcome to the Network Control at Hitachi!

Network Control provides leading network management and control systems for planned and unplanned outage management, generation, transmission and distribution management systems, SCADA and process control solutions for planning, forecasting and running day-to-day operations. Offerings comprise a broad range of solutions to address the most critical needs of utility and power companies.

We are looking for a system engineer with a broad profile that can manage several of the installation and integration activities in our project deliveries. The work will consist of delivering professional services in our projects as well as improving our installation methods and system solutions. Main part of the work will be performed at our office and in our test room, but you will also participate in the commissioning at our customer sites. How you’ll make an impact

You will be part of a skilled and engaged team where you will have responsibility for installation, configuration, testing and commissioning of the systems in our delivery projects

Setup of system administration and security environments including active directory, kerberos, group policies and DNS

Installation of different software components and third party’s products for the system platform, databases and cyber security functions

Configuration and test of SCADA functions

Implement bug corrections and upgrades of the customer systems

Maintain and update project development environment with customer configurations and project deviations, including source code, configuration files and installation kits

Creating clear detailed documentation of the system configuration including system diagrams, configuration descriptions, sizing and user policies

Participate in FAT and SAT in close collaboration with our customers, including conducting customer trainings

Your background

Experience in installation and system administration of Linux and Windows servers both in physical environments and virtual environments (vmware and HyperV)

Master’s or bachelor degree in software engineering, computer engineering or equivalent acquired experience

Documented experience in working with installation of Network Manager or similar SCADA/EMS/DMS computer systems

A creative mindset, combined with ability to seek information, knowledge of how to solve technical problems and the ability to understand and write at least one scripting language (PowerShell, Linux Shell, Perl, VBS)

Experience in setup and configuration of computers and servers including IP and network configuration, firmware updates, disk setup and partitioning, OS installation and hardening

Fluency in English and Swedish, both written and spoken is a must

Hitachi Energy is a global technology leader in electrification, powering a sustainable energy future through innovative power grid technologies with digital at the core. Over three billion people depend on our technologies to power their daily lives.

With over a century in pioneering mission-critical technologies like high-voltage, transformers, automation, and power electronics, we are addressing the most urgent energy challenge of our time – balancing soaring electricity demand, while decarbonizing the power system.

Headquartered in Switzerland, we employ over 50,000 people in 60 countries and generate revenues of around $16 billion USD. We welcome you to apply today.
